The full breakdown

What it's made of and why it matters

This shirt is a polyester-cotton blend knit, a standard construction for athletic training wear. Polyester provides durability and moisture-wicking; cotton adds breathability and comfort. The blend itself poses no inherent chemical hazard at wear, though both fibers are processed with dyes and finishing agents during manufacture. No specialty water-repellent or stain-resistant coating is indicated on this product, which eliminates a major source of intentional PFAS or other problematic treatments in athletic apparel.

The brand's record and disclosure

Reebok (owned by Authentic Brands Group as of 2022) does not publicly disclose detailed chemical or PFAS management policies for apparel as standard practice. The brand has faced no major safety recalls specific to formaldehyde, azo dyes, or heavy metals in recent training wear. Industry disclosure on this product line is minimal, but absence of reported incidents in this category suggests compliance with basic U.S. and EU textile safety standards.

How it compares in its category

Standard polyester-cotton athletic tees are among the lowest-hazard clothing items available. This product sits in the mainstream market segment without specialty finishes, making it comparable to typical gym wear from Nike, Adidas, or Target athletic lines. No notable safety advantages or disadvantages relative to peers; the main variable across brands is manufacturing process transparency rather than inherent material risk.

Beyond PFAS: other things we checked

Established hazard classes for this product type, assessed from public information. These never change the PFAS grade; a Likely flag caps the Verdict at “Buy with care.”

Possible

Azo dyes and residual dye chemicals

Polyester knits are typically dyed with azo or reactive dyes. Reebok does not disclose dye chemistry or restricted substance testing for this specific product, and no recalls are on record; however, residual unreacted dye can persist on unwashed garments and contact skin.

Possible

Formaldehyde resins in finish treatments

Cotton-polyester blends are sometimes treated with formaldehyde-based wrinkle-resistant finishes to improve dimensional stability. Reebok's product specifications do not confirm or exclude such treatments; standard athletic wear typically uses lower formaldehyde levels than dress shirts, but pre-wash testing is not disclosed.

None known

Antimony in polyester

Antimony trioxide is used as a catalyst in polyester synthesis and can leach in trace amounts. No specific testing or incidents reported for Reebok training wear; typical polyester apparel contains very low residual antimony, and dermal exposure during normal wear is considered negligible by textile safety standards.

Reported

Microplastic shedding during washing

Polyester garments shed microfibers during machine washing, a known environmental concern rather than direct wearer hazard. This product will shed like typical polyester blends; mitigation requires use of a microfiber catch filter or washing bag, not a brand-specific issue.

Possible

Heavy metals in pigments (if dark dyes used)

Dark colors in polyester may use pigments containing trace cadmium or lead, though most major brands have reduced these since the 2010s. Reebok does not publish heavy metal testing results; dermal absorption during wear is considered low risk, but repeated skin contact with unwashed dark garments carries theoretical exposure.
